The OCPM Advocates is an outreach team of people committed to educating and increasing awareness of Orthodox Christian Prison Ministry in his or her church.
The OCPM Advocates support our mission by maintaining vital streams of communication between OCPM and your church, educating your community on volunteer and giving opportunities, and bringing at least one Advocate Initiative to your church every year.
